Pressure mounts over health and economic pledges as Sunak campaigns to shore-up Conservative heartlands in poll test

• Read more: NHS crisis deepens as nurses plan ‘mega strike’

A prolonged NHS crisis stoked by further strikes risks derailing Rishi Sunak’s local election plans amid Tory concern that the prime minister is already facing pressure over flagship pledges on health and the economy.

The prime minister will head to the south-east this week as he attempts to shore up Tory heartland seats where traditional supporters had been put off by the chaos of the Johnson and Truss regimes. However, opposition parties have reported findings that the NHS remains the most salient issue among soft Tory voters.
